How to Choose the Right Dining Table Materials for Outdoor Spaces

Arc Collection_Dining Table Materials

When guests take their seats at a hotel or restaurant, their experience starts with the space—not just the food. The dining table plays a big part in that. It’s more than furniture—it’s a key part of your brand’s identity.

Before choosing a material, it’s important to know the challenges that outdoor furniture must handle. Think of restaurant patios, rooftop cafés, beach clubs, or resort spaces. These settings demand more from tables than private indoor areas. Your furniture needs to look great and stay strong despite heavy use and unpredictable weather.

Here are the top things to keep in mind when picking materials for commercial outdoor dining tables:

1. Built to Withstand the Weather

Outdoor tables need to handle blazing sun, heavy rain, high humidity, and strong wind. Materials that soak up water, rust, or crack won’t last long. Go for weatherproof furniture made specifically for tropical or four-season climates.

2. Ready for High-Traffic Use

Busy outdoor spaces mean your tables will be used constantly, shifted around, and expected to stay rock solid. Choose materials built for it all—from relaxed brunches to full dinner service.

3. Match the Look and Feel of Your Brand

Each material sets a tone. Teak gives a warm, natural vibe. Natural stones feels sleek and upscale. Choose one that not only performs well but also fits your brand and outdoor concept visually.

4. Low Maintenance, Long-Term Value

Time and money spent on maintenance adds up fast. Some materials stain easily or need special care. Instead, choose something that’s tough, stylish, and easy to maintain—so your team can focus on what matters most.

Best Material Combinations for Outdoor Dining Tables

Aluminium Frame + Teak Wood Surface

A great balance of strength and beauty. Aluminium offers a lightweight, weather-resistant frame. Teak brings warmth and a luxurious touch.

Aluminium Frame + Natural Stone Surface

This combo brings modern vibes and premium durability. Aluminium stays strong and light outdoors. Porcelanic stone gives you a beautiful surface that handles heat and scratches.

Teak Wood Frame + Stone Surface

Strong, stylish, and long-lasting. Teak gives a solid natural base, while the stone top adds a premium look that holds up to sun, spills, and scratches.

Teak Wood Frame + Teak Wood Surface

A full teak setup gives a cozy, refined feel. It’s strong, weather-resistant, and timeless—ideal for spaces that want a classic tropical aesthetic.

Aluminium Frame + Aluminium Surface

Lightweight, modern, and tough. Aluminium works well in both humid and dry climates. It’s also super easy to clean—great for busy outdoor settings.
